DataGrip 2022 for mac(数据库管理工具)
详情介绍
DataGrip 2022 for mac(数据库管理工具)新特性
1、智能查询控制台允许您以不同的模式执行查询,并提供本地历史记录,以跟踪您的所有活动并防止您丢失工作。
2、高效的模式导航
通过相应的操作或直接从SQL代码中的用法中,可以按其名称跳转到任何表,视图或过程。
3、解释计划
使您可以深入了解查询的工作方式以及数据库引擎的行为,从而可以提高查询效率。
4、智能代码完成
DataGrip提供上下文相关的代码完成功能,帮助您更快地编写SQL代码。完成了解表结构,外键,甚至是您正在编辑的代码中创建的数据库对象。
5、动态分析和快速修复
DataGrip可以检测代码中可能存在的错误,并提出最佳解决方案,以进行实时修复。使用关键字作为标识符,它将立即让您知道未解决的对象,并且始终提供解决问题的方法。
软件功能
一、探索你的数据库DataGrip是多引擎数据库环境。我们支持MySQL,PostgreSQL,Microsoft SQL Server,Oracle,Sybase,DB2,SQLite,HyperSQL,Apache Derby和H2。如果DBMS具有JDBC驱动程序,则可以通过DataGrip连接到JDBC驱动程序。对于任何支持的引擎,它提供数据库内省和用于创建和修改对象的各种工具。
1、数据库对象
DataGrip介绍数据库中的所有对象,并按模式将其显示在文件夹中。它还提供用于添加和编辑表,列,索引,约束等的UI。
2、导航
快速导航无论您是否在代码中创建了任何对象,或者已经从数据库中读取,都会带给您任何对象。导航到符号动作可以让您以他们的名字找到对象。
3、表编辑器
强大的表编辑器允许您添加,删除,编辑和克隆数据行。通过外键浏览数据,并使用文本搜索查找表编辑器中显示的数据中的任何内容。
二、智能编码协助
就像任何体面的IDE一样,DataGrip提供智能代码完成,代码检查,即时错误突出显示和快速修复以及重构功能。通过使编写SQL代码的过程更有效率,可以节省您的时间。
1、代码完成
DataGrip提供了上下文相关的模式感知代码完成,可帮助您更快地编写代码。完成意识到您正在编辑的代码中创建的表结构,外键以及数据库对象。
2、代码生成
忘记手动编写典型代码:DataGrip将为您做这些。它基于UI生成用于更改表,列等对象的代码。此外,它可以帮助您获取表的DDL,并从结果集提供DML查询。
3、重命名并找到用法
DataGrip正确解析了SQL文件中的所有引用。当您从SQL重命名数据库对象时,它们也将在数据库中重命名。您可以了解使用哪个存储过程,函数或视图。
4、代码分析和快速修复
DataGrip可以检测您的SQL代码中的可能错误,并建议最佳的选项来即时修复它们。它将立即让您了解未解决的对象,使用关键字作为标识符,并始终提供一种解决问题的方法。
5、智能文本编辑器
就像任何IntelliJ平台IDE一样,DataGrip包括代码编辑器,可以帮助您提高效率。转换和移动代码块,使用多光标来管理选择,根据特定样式格式化代码等等。
6、自定义外观
DataGrip配有浅色和深色的外观和感觉主题。他们每个都可以完全定制,所以你可以创建一个最适合你的。十个预先配置的键盘映射相同。
三、运行查询
编写查询是无法运行的。DataGrip中的查询控制台是任何SQL开发人员的基本工具。创建多个控制台,每个控制台都有自己的模式和查询选项。
1、查询控制台
指定运行查询的控制台行为:选择要执行的操作 - 最小的语句或最大的语句。
2、当地历史
每个控制台支持模式切换,并提供本地历史记录,跟踪您的所有活动,并保护您免于失去工作。
3、差异查看器
使用差异阅读器比较在当地历史上两个命令行快照或两个查询结果DataGrip突出的差异,并允许您通过管理比较标准公差参数。
四、导入/导出选项
除此之外,DataGrip还提供用户参数支持,CSV编辑器,图表构建器,版本控制支持以及许多其他功能。
1、导入CSV
享受专门的用户界面,将CSV和TSV文件导入数据库。可以将要导入的文件的每一列映射到数据库中的表列,这可以是在导入过程中创建的现有表或新表。
2、导出为文本
任何表格或结果集都可以以各种格式导出,包括CSV,JSON,XML和HTML。您甚至可以创建自己的导出格式。
3、导出为查询
任何表或结果集也可以呈现为一批UPDATE或INSERT语句,这对修改数据有帮助。
五、杂项功能
除此之外,DataGrip还提供用户参数支持,CSV编辑器,图表构建器,版本控制支持以及许多其他功能。
1、用户参数
DataGrip支持运行参数化的SQL查询。使用正则表达式添加您自己的参数模式,并选择要应用这些模式的SQL方言。
2、执行计划
语句的执行计划可视地表示数据库执行的操作,以返回查询所需的数据。并帮助您优化查询。选择以图形或表格格式查看计划。
3、图表
探索你的表和他们的关系在一个有见地的图表。也可以直接从数据库对象修改数据库对象。
软件特色
1、提供了对主流数据库管理系统的访问市场上的重量级产品:Oracle、SQL Server、DB2与Sybase
社区流行产品:MySQL、PostgreSQL
小众产品:SQLite、Apache Derby、HyperSQL与H2
2、修改数据库对象并自动生成脚本
DataGrip提供了一个UI用以执行诸如创建/修改表、管理列、键与索引的操作。可以立即执行生成的代码,也可以在文本编辑器中打开,并直接操作DDL脚本。DataGrip提供了上下文感知的代码完成特性,能够帮助你更快地编写SQL代码。代码完成可以感知到表结构、外键,甚至是正在编辑的代码中所创建的数据库对象。DataGrip可以检测到代码中潜在的Bug,并即时提供最佳的修复建议。它能够立刻让你知道无法解析的对象,并且总能提供问题的修复建议。
3、高效编写SQL并消除重复的编码工作
借助于DataGrip,你可以通过代码完成特性更快地编写代码。只需输入数据库对象、标识符或是变量的名字即可,DataGrip会提供一个匹配的列表。DataGrip能够感知到完成JOIN从句所需的依赖,并提供函数与过程所需的参数类型,还可以给出INSERT语句的表结构。DataGrip提供了Live Templates用以生成语句的常见部分,你可以使用默认值,也可以创建新值。
4、在代码间导航并在输入时进行重命名
DataGrip能够解析出SQL文件中的对象引用。如果对变量或是别名进行了重命名,那么所有用到他们的地方都会相应地进行重命名。如果在SQL中重命名了数据库对象,实际的数据库中也会进行重命名。DataGrip能够正确解析出SQL代码中所有的引用,并帮助你对其进行重构。
IDE会展示出对象(表、列等等)的使用,还会在专门的视图中展示出变量。导航工具可以帮助你在编辑器、模式视图等各种上下文中选择对象。
5、处理数据并探索关系
你可以通过强大的表编辑器添加、删除、以及克隆数据行。通过过滤文本域可以只查看所需的数据,而无需编写WHERE字句。寻找所需数据的另一种方式是使用文本搜索。如果不知道哪一列包含了你所要寻找的数据,那么文本搜索就是一项非常有用的功能了。可以在文本搜索中使用正则表达式。通过外键数据导航可以转到当前行所引用的数据,反之亦然。
6、分析查询与比较结果
在单击Execute按钮时可以选择让DataGrip做什么事情——执行子查询、执行外部查询,或是执行整个脚本。只想执行特定的一部分代码?只需将其选中并执行即可。DataGrip还提供了执行计划,其结果集类似于表编辑器,包含了相同的选项,如添加/删除行、文本搜索与数据导航等。可以在diff查看器中比较两个结果集。
更新日志
v2022.3.3版本通过设置可用的新 UI
新的设置同步解决方案
修复
DBE-6156:现在支持 Oracle SET ROW。
DBE-12766:现在支持 SQL Server $PARTITION。
此处提供完整的更改列表
其他版本
-
Datagrip 2021 for mac v2021.3.4官方版 编程开发 / 449.84M
相同厂商
-
PhpStorm 2024 for Mac官方版 v2024.1.4 编程开发 / 773.07M
-
JetBrains Pycharm Mac社区版 v2024.1.4官方版 编程开发 / 598.31M
-
Rider mac版 v2023.3官方版 编程开发 / 1017.92M
同类软件
JetBrains CLion 2024 for Mac官方版 v2024.1.4
JetBrains RubyMine 2023 for mac v2023.3.6
JSON Wizard for Mac v2.2官方版
CudaText for mac(跨平台代码编辑器) v1.195.0.5官方版
Coda for mac(网页编程工具) v2.7.7
DW网页设计软件mac版(Adobe Dreamweaver) v21.3官方版
DbWrench for mac(可视化数据库设计工具) v5.0官方版
MultiMarkdown Composer Pro for Mac版 v4.5.12官方版
相关文章
- 教程
网友评论
共0条评论类似软件
-
Querious Mac版 v4.0.12官方版 编程开发 / 49.15M
-
DBeaverUE for Mac(数据库管理软件) v24.1.3双芯片版 编程开发 / 241.04M
-
Navicat Data Modeler Mac版 v3.3.17官方版 编程开发 / 188.79M
精彩发现
换一换精品推荐
-
chrome插件postman Mac版 v11.19.0.0官方版 编程开发 / 256.8M
查看 -
Dash for mac(API文档和代码片段管理器) v7.2.4官方版 编程开发 / 19.39M
查看 -
JetBrains Pycharm Mac社区版 v2024.1.4官方版 编程开发 / 598.31M
查看 -
Zend Studio 13 Mac中文版 v13.6.1官方版 编程开发 / 295.91M
查看 -
010 editor 8 for Mac直装中文版 v8.0.1 编程开发 / 20M
查看